This instruction implements the USAF Pararescue and Combat Rescue Officer training program and applies to all active duty, reserve, and guard PJ and CRO personnel, consolidating training and certification

How long is a CRO?
A: A CRO typically deploys for 120 days every 18 months and is TDY 30% of the time while not deployed. Q: Can I apply to be a CRO if I am a civilian? A: No. You have to be in the military in some capacity so that you can attend Phase II on military orders.
How long is air force cro training?
Training (CRO/STO) Cadets interested in CRO/STO fields have a very specific application process that includes two phases of training while in ROTC, and if selected, the approximately 2-year-long training pipeline after commissioning.

How hard is it to be a CRO?
CAREER FIELD ELIGIBILITY: The demands of a CRO are high and outstanding leadership qualities are required. Exceptional personal responsibility and maturity, strong analytical decision making, logical reasoning, excellent physical fitness and mental fortitude are essential characteristics of a CRO.
Is a CRO a PJ?
The majority of the force are Pararescuemen. The leaders of the PJ's are the Combat Rescue Officers nicknamed CRO's (phonetically sounds like "crows". The PJs and CROs are required to meet the same standards to graduate from the CRO/PJ School. CRO's and PJ's are commonly both referred to as PJ's.
